The Montour Wildlife Management Area is located on the floodplain of the Payette River. Its lowlands are a complex of cottonwood-willow river bottoms, wetlands and ponds, and agricultureal fields adjacent to the Payette River.
Montour should still have numbers of migrating warblers and vireos. There will be a chance for Rails, Soras, Snipe and a variety of waterfowl. At higher elevations expect Cranes, Woodpeckers, Flycatchers and Vireos.
This will be a full day trip mostly driving with stops to get out and bird at specific locations. We will park in the Montour Wildlife Management Area and walk for a mile or so. The terrain is a level dirt road. We will take a restroom break at the campground before leaving.
From Montour we will drive up the valley through Sweet and Ola, then up to High Valley and on to Sage Hen Reservoir. Above Ola the roads are dirt but generally passable by passenger cars all the way to Sage Hen. This may change depending on snow melt. There are vault toilets at Sage Hen. We will return by the same route. It is possible to continue east from Sage Hen down to Smith’s Ferry in high-clearance vehicles.
